Share goes to wrong folder?

Hi all,

Weird one! - ReadyNAS 2100 running 4.2.19

I have a share called Veeam - only shared with CIFS, no access restrictions. When you browse to \\NAS01 you see the Veeam share in Windows explorer but if you open it the folder contents are that of a ReadyNAS replicate share. However if you go to \\NAS01\c\Veeam you get the correct contents of the Veeam folder.

Only noticed as my backups were failing in Veeam as they couldn't find the storage - if I change the target to \\NAS01\c\Veeam\Jobx then they work.

Why is the share pointing to the wrong folder?

Re: Share goes to wrong folder?

Think I might have fixed it.... Renamed my 'Veeam' share to 'Backup' then renamed it back to 'Veeam' again (All in Frontview) and now it seems to be behaving itself - share is directing to the correct folder (For now.....)

Will check again later and report back.
